## Authentication

As of release 4.2, the Ledgermill payroll export switched from CSV to the column-delimited PRX format, and the export endpoint now requires authenticated requests. On-call engineers should note that the old anonymous export path returns 410 Gone. Authenticate by passing the service key in the request header; tokens are validated by the Hearthgate auth proxy and cached for five minutes. For emergency manual exports, use the key below.

service key, fawip-bajef: kto11_Qt5wZK9vdNC

## Deploying the Gatewick Proctor Queue

Deploys are pretty painless: push to main, wait for the pipeline, then watch the queue drain dashboard for five minutes. If candidates pile up mid-exam, roll back first and ask questions later — the queue replays safely. Everything the workers care about lives in one config block, shown here for reference.

settings of bafof-yagef:
JOROX_PIN=8740
JOROX_TENANT=pelox
JOROX_METRICS_HOST=metrics.jorox.qorvelworks.internal
JOROX_SEAL=seal_c78f63c1
JOROX_STANDBY_TEAM=norax

Changelog — LintQuill 3.2.0

Renamed setting: DOCLINT_TOKEN is now QUILL_API_TOKEN to match the rest of the QUILL_* namespace. The old name is no longer read as of this release; there is no fallback. Update every environment file that runs the linter in CI before upgrading. For reference, the replacement entry in each env file should read:

sealed setting: VAULT_KEY20=69e2a0b23f1a79fbf692